百度360必应搜狗淘宝本站头条
当前位置:网站首页 > 技术文章 > 正文

阿里架构师整理一份企业级SSM架构实战文档,让你熟悉底层原理

ccwgpt 2024-10-29 13:30 26 浏览 0 评论

前言

通常我们按规模把软件分为小型软件、中型软件和大型软件,而大型软件的应用客户都是大型企业或商业组织等,所以业内习惯将大型软件称为企业级应用。

传统的企业级应用开发提供的是信息化解决方案和应用软件,需要合理地解决企业复杂的功能、结构,协调数量众多的外部资源并处理大量数据、多用户并发,安全性也是考虑的重点。企业级应用通常由多个应用组成,这些应用互相连接,也可能与其他企业的相关应用连接,因而构成庞大的应用集群。

现在,随着互联网的发展,大数据处理成为互联网公司主要依赖的技术手段。高并发是互联网最重要的特征,所以企业级应用也包括了大规模、多层、可扩展、可靠的、安全的网络应用程序,很多大型网站都可以归为企业级应用的范畴。

由于文档的内容过多,只截取了目录部分,每一章都有更细化的知识点解析!!
需要领取完整SSM架构实战文档的朋友们可以关注我私信【架构书籍】领取

知识点重点目录

第1章:企业开发概述

本章节重点

  1. 瀑布模型开发流程
  2. SQL与NOSQL的区别
  3. SSH与SSM的区别

学完你能掌握

  1. 了解软件开发流程和文档
  2. 了解数据库和操作系统的区别
  3. 了解SSH和SSM框架的组成

第2章:Spring 架构设计

章节重点

  1. Spring应用场景
  2. Spring子项目
  3. Spring设计目标
  4. Spring整体架构

学完你能掌握

  1. 熟悉Spring子项目
  2. 熟悉Spring3.2整体架构
  3. 了解Spring4.0新特性

第3章:Spring核心概念loC

本章重点

  1. loC/DI工作原理
  2. 配置Spring使用环境
  3. 使用Spring编写程序
  4. Bean作用域

学完你能掌握

  1. 了解Spring解耦合的原理
  2. 会使用Spring编写程序

第4章:Spring核心概念AOP

本章重点

  1. 代理模式
  2. AOP术语和种类
  3. 编写Spring AOP程序

学完你能掌握

  1. 掌握Spring AOP的相关术语
  2. 会使用Spring AOP编写程序

第5章:Spring应用扩展

本章重点

  1. 多配置文件
  2. 装配多种数据类型
  3. 使用注解装配

学完你能掌握

  1. 掌握多配置文件
  2. 掌握注解loC和AOP

第6章:Spring MVC映射控制器

本章重点

  1. Spring MVC的工作流程
  2. 映射控制器使用方式
  3. 多功能控制器
  4. 注解实现Spring MVC

学完你能掌握

  1. 掌握多功能控制器
  2. 掌握注解驱动Spring MVC

第7章:Spring MVC绑定校验

本章重点

  1. Spring MVC数据绑定
  2. Spring MVC数据校验

学完你能掌握

  1. 掌握数据绑定的实现方式
  2. 掌握数据校验的实现方式

第8章:Spring MVC核心应用

本章重点

  1. 文件上传
  2. 拦截器
  3. 类型转换
  4. 请求转发与重定向
  5. 异常处理

学完你能掌握

  1. 掌握文件上传
  2. 掌握拦截器
  3. 掌握异常处理

第9章:MyBatis配置

本章重点

  1. MyBatis的使用方式
  2. 动态SQL

学完你能掌握

掌握MyBatis的使用方法

第10章:MyBatis高级应用

本章重点

  1. 对象关联
  2. 延迟加载
  3. 缓存
  4. Spring集成MyBatis
  5. 动态SQL

学完你能掌握

  1. 掌握MyBatis关联对象的使用方法
  2. 掌握延迟加载的方法
  3. 掌握Spring集成MyBatis的配置方式
  4. 掌握Spring管理事务的方法

第11章:SSM 框架整合

本章重点

  1. 包结构规划
  2. SSM配置

学完你能掌握

  1. 编写登录、退出功能
  2. 动态菜单

第12章:项目实战: SL会员商城

本章重点

  1. 软件开发周期
  2. 软件过程模型
  3. 需求分析的过程
  4. 概要设计和详细设计的过程
  5. 项目实战

学完你能掌握

  1. 掌握需求分析的过程
  2. 掌握面向对象程序设计方法
  3. 综合应用SSM框架完成实战项目开发

由于文档的内容过多,只截取了目录部分,每一章都有更细化的知识点解析!!

由于文档的内容过多,只截取了目录部分,每一章都有更细化的知识点解析!!
需要领取完整SSM架构实战文档的朋友们可以关注我私信【架构书籍】领取


相关推荐

Java七大热门技术框架源码解析(25章) 完结

获课》aixuetang.xyz/5699/Hibernate与MyBatis源码级PK:ORM框架的两种哲学在Java持久层框架领域,Hibernate与MyBatis代表了两种截然不同的设计哲学。...

【25章】Java七大热门技术框架源码解析

获课》aixuetang.xyz/5699/Java高级面试:七大框架源码精讲与实战解析在当今Java技术生态中,对主流框架源码的深入理解已成为高级开发者面试的核心竞争力。掌握Spring、MyBat...

饿了么董事长吴泽明兼任CEO,韩鎏分管即时物流中心

饿了么调整组织架构。2月11日,饿了么董事长吴泽明(花名:范禹)通过公司全员信宣布饿了么最新组织调整:即日起,吴泽明将兼任饿了么CEO,韩鎏(花名:昊宸)专注分管即时物流中心,继续向吴泽明汇报。吴泽明...

饿了么100%迁至阿里云,快速扩容可支持1亿人同时点单

来源:环球网6月17日,记者获悉,饿了么已完成100%上云,所有业务系统、数据库设施等均已迁移至阿里云。高峰期,饿了么可在阿里云上快速扩容,可以支持1亿人同时在线点单,这意味着饿了么的服务能力再次全面...

饿了么组织架构调整:董事长吴泽明兼任CEO 韩鎏专注即时物流中心管理

近日,饿了么董事长吴泽明(花名:范禹)通过公司全员信宣布饿了么最新组织调整:即日起,吴泽明将兼任饿了么CEO,韩鎏(花名:昊宸)专注分管即时物流中心,继续向吴泽明汇报。吴泽明在内部信中表示,考虑即时物...

饿了么组织架构调整:董事长吴泽明兼任CEO

Tech星球2月11日消息,据新浪科技报道,今日饿了么董事长吴泽明(花名:范禹)通过公司全员信宣布饿了么最新组织调整:即日起,吴泽明将兼任饿了么CEO,韩鎏(花名:昊宸)专注分管即时物流中心,继续向吴...

饿了么又调整了组织架构,董事长吴泽明兼任CEO

2月11日,饿了么董事长,花名为范禹的吴泽明,通过公司全员信宣布最新组织调整:从即日起,吴泽明将兼任饿了么CEO。公司原CEO,花名为昊宸的韩鎏今后专注分管即时物流中心,继续向吴泽明汇报。在内部信中,...

SpringBoot项目快速开发框架JeecgBoot——Web处理!

Web处理JeecgBoot框架主要用于Web开发领域。下面介绍JeecgBoot在Web开发中的常用功能,如控制器、登录、系统菜单、权限模块的角色管理和用户管理。首先启动后台项目,将其导入IDE...

腾讯即将开源Kuikly:基于Kotlin的纯原生跨端解决方案

IT之家3月4日消息,腾讯日前在端服务网站发布预告,即将开源Kuikly跨端开发框架。预告海报介绍称,Kuikly是基于KotlinKMM技术、客户端开发友好的全新跨端解决方案,可...

Python构建MCP服务器完整教程:5步打造专属AI工具调用系统

模型控制协议(ModelControlProtocol,MCP)是一种专为实现AI代理与工具解耦而设计的通信协议,为AI驱动应用程序的开发提供了高度的灵活性和模块化架构。通过MCP服务器,AI代...

Python3使用diagrams生成架构图(python模块制作)

目录技术背景diagrams的安装基础逻辑关系图组件簇的定义总结概要参考链接技术背景对于一个架构师或者任何一个软件工程师而言,绘制架构图都是一个比较值得学习的技能。这就像我们学习的时候整理的一些Xmi...

Python 失宠!Hugging Face 用 Rust 新写了一个 ML框架,现已低调开源

大数据文摘受权转载自AI前线整理|褚杏娟近期,HuggingFace低调开源了一个重磅ML框架:Candle。Candle一改机器学习惯用Python的做法,而是Rust编写,重...

Python Web 框架(Python Web 框架)

Tornado、Flask、Django三个PythonWeb框架的主要区别和适用场景:特点/框架TornadoFlaskDjango类型异步非阻塞Web服务器和框架轻量级微框架全功能...

构建并发布你的自定义 Python 包(python如何创建自定义模块)

Python让你可以重用代码,并将代码分享给他人以节省时间和精力。所以,当你编写了一些方便的脚本,希望你的同事或其他人也能使用时,接下来该怎么做呢?这篇文章就来解决打包和分发的问题。我们将专注于将你...

Python 应用开发框架 BeeWare 简明实用教程

1.BeeWare简介BeeWare是一个Python框架,用于开发跨平台原生应用。它支持Android、iOS、Windows、macOS和Linux,并提供原生用户体验。2.安装B...

取消回复欢迎 发表评论: